India P&I Club: The Future of Marine Insurance in India
The launch of the India P&I Club is a landmark move toward self-reliance. It offers domestic, affordable marine liability insurance in India, covering third-party risks like oil spills, crew injury, and pollution, traditionally handled by foreign insurers. This move strengthens maritime sovereignty and empowers local shipowners.

Marine DSU Policy: Protecting Cargo from Financial Delays
The Marine DSU Policy (Delay in Start-Up) is vital for major infrastructure projects. It protects against massive financial losses—such as lost profits, fixed costs, and debt service—caused by the delayed arrival of critical project cargo during transit. This specialized coverage is essential for mitigating risks where a logistical delay can halt an entire project's timeline.
